WebNov 15, 2024 · HCBS programs are often funded by state waivers. Waivers are part of a state's Medicaid program, but they provide a special group of services to a certain population. Waivers usually require medical and financial eligibility, but state waiver eligibility requirements may not be exactly the same as state Medicaid eligibility. WebMinnesota requires authorization for all PCA services and pays the state plan rate for PCA services regardless of whether the services are approved through a state plan authorization or an HCBS waiver authorization. In Minnesota there are approximately 132 lead agencies (county or tribal nation) that administer HCBS waiver programs. WebFeb 27, 2024 · Specific to Nursing Home Medicaid and HCBS Medicaid Waivers, there is a 60-month Look Back Period. This prohibits applicants from transferring assets for less than fair market value. Violations result in a Penalty Period of Medicaid ineligibility. can wanna get away flights be changed

WebApr 5, 2024 · The Minnesota Elderly Waiver is a 1915 (c) Home and Community Based Services (HCBS) Medicaid waiver. Medicaid in Minnesota is called Medical Assistance (MA). WebSep 28, 2024 · Medicaid HCBS Waivers Waivers are state-specific programs that are intended to prevent or delay the placement of elderly, frail, or disabled persons in nursing homes.
